THE OPPORTUNITY

The Intermediate Accountant will be responsible for assisting the Accounting Manager and Accounting Supervisor in the day-to-day, monthly, quarterly, and year end activities of the Head Office Accounting Department. This is a dynamic position that provides the opportunity to work alongside experienced CPA's and gain valuable experience towards your CPA designation.

This position is located at our corporate headquarters in Burnaby, B.C.

YOUR RESPONSIBILITIES

  • Prepares, reviews, analyzes and distributes monthly financial statements for operating branches, including the reconciliation and analysis of general ledger accounts
  • Prepares bank reconciliations and investigates outstanding items
  • Reconciles and maintains fixed assets
  • Prepares Statistics Canada quarterly reports
  • Prepares sales tax remittances and returns (US and Canadian)
  • Analyzes parts inventory semi-annually
  • Prepares year end files, account analyses and supporting documentation for external auditors
  • Assists with various ad hoc projects and tasks as required
